Landslides and hazardous conditions on roads in Cyprus

Due to adverse weather conditions, rockfalls and soil collapses were recorded on a number of roads in the mountainous areas of Troodos on Saturday afternoon. Police are urging drivers to exercise increased caution.
Landslides were noted on the following sections:
- Evrychou – Kakopetria – Karvounas
- Kakopetria – Pinewood – Pedoulas
- Pedoulas – Kykkos – Kambos – Orkonda
The region is experiencing dense fog, water accumulation, and slippery road surfaces, which significantly reduce visibility.
In addition, rockfalls have been recorded on the Nicosia – Larnaca motorway in the areas of Lymbia and Athienou – Kosia. Traffic on the motorway continues, however the situation remains potentially dangerous.
Police recommend:
- reducing speed
- keeping a safe distance
- turning on headlights
- strictly following road signs
Drivers are urged to be especially attentive on sections with standing water and limited visibility.
